Help your school’s parents connect with and protect their kids.

Whether your school’s parents are concerned about their elementary school-aged children learning to use search engines or managing their high schoolers’ fast-paced involvement with social networking sites, this 2008 Disney iParenting media award-winning guide offers easy-to-understand tips and information to enable the best experiences possible. Written by renowned Internet Safety Advocate Marian Merritt of Norton security by Symantec, the guide also features an introduction by Miss America 2007, Lauren Nelson. Merritt frequently appears on national TV and radio shows to assist parents trying to bridge the technology gap between themselves and their cyber-savvy kids.

Topics include:
  • Educational/guidelines for all age-groups:
    • Elementary school children (5-7),
    • Tweens (ages 8-12),
    • Teens (ages 13-17),
    • and College-bound
  • Safe browsing practices
  • Internet predators
  • Social Networking Sites
  • Email and Instant Messaging
  • Online Gaming, Shopping and Bill Payment
  • Blogging
  • Parental Control Software and much more
